SPEECH AND LANGUAGE THERAPIST

THE ORGANISATION:

AsIAm is Ireland’s National Autism Charity based in Blackrock,
Co.Dublin. AsIAm is a fast paced, growing organisation with a vision
to create a society where every autistic person is accepted “as they
are” – equal, valued, and respected. The organisation’s purpose
is to advocate for an inclusive society for autistic people that is
accessible, accepted and affirming. AsIAm works to support the
Autistic community and our families to fully engage in Irish life and
build the capacity of society to facilitate true inclusion.

THE ROLE:

This is an exciting opportunity for a senior or a basic grade Speech
and Language Therapist with appropriate experience to join our
organisation and make a real difference in the lives of autistic
children and their families. The SLT on our AAC Support Programme,
will report directly to the Clinical Lead /Senior SLT on the
programme. They will be responsible for developing and delivering an
AAC support programme to families and professionals. This role
provides an ideal opportunity for someone who has experience in
directly supporting clients with AAC, as well as delivering effective
neuro-affirmative training and therapeutic supports to autistic people
and their families.

The successful candidate will have the ability to communicate in a
sensitive and professional manner with autistic individuals and
families. They will also have the ability to provide both informal and
formal training on AAC and communication. The role requires the
successful candidate to work with the AAC programme manager to develop
resources, training, services and referral pathways.

This post is suitable for a Speech and Language Therapist with a
minimum of three years post graduate clinical Speech and Language
Therapy experience. Clinical experience in working with high tech
communication devices is highly desirable. Clinical experience in
supporting the communication of autistic children and providing parent
training and support is desirable.
